Our January meeting of the Rochester Area Democratic Club will take place Thursday, January 9, at Miguel's Cantina, 870 Rochester Rd, Rochester Hills (W. side of Rochester Rd, a bit north of Avon). The meeting starts at 7pm, but many Democrats gather at 6:30pm to order what they would like to eat during the meeting. It helps the wait staff if you pay with cash so they don't have to make so many trips to tables for a group as large as ours.

Our guest speaker will be the current Oakland County Executive Dave Coulter who is running for re-election this year.

Our January meeting will also include an election for an Officer-at-Large from Oakland Township. The Nominations Committee has recommended Lisa Kiefer for this position and she has accepted the opportunity. Additional nominations may be made from the floor by the membership. But, keep in mind that our by-laws state that "in no case shall any member be nominated who has not been a RADC member in good standing for at least 30 days immediately preceding the meeting." In addition, this Officer must be an elected Precinct Delegate from Oakland Township.

Since this is an election meeting, please sign in near the beverage bar in the southwest corner of the room to receive an election card for voting. Those who can vote have been members in good standing at least 30 days immediately preceding this January meeting.
